Attaching a Charm to a Necklace or Bracelet

Once a charm is selected, attaching it to a necklace or bracelet is a relatively simple process. Most charms feature a jump ring, a small metal loop that allows them to be connected to a chain. Pliers are used to gently open the jump ring, slide it onto the chain or pendant, and then close it securely. It is important to ensure the ends of the jump ring meet closely to prevent it from coming loose. Some jewelry designers offer services to attach the charm for a fee, providing a convenient option for those less comfortable with jewelry assembly.

Materials and Craftsmanship

Birthstone charms are crafted from a variety of materials, with a focus on quality and durability. High-quality metals such as 14k-gold plated sterling silver are frequently used for their ability to complement the vibrant colors of the gemstones. The use of recycled sterling silver is also becoming increasingly common, reflecting a commitment to sustainable practices. Charms are often handcrafted, adding a unique touch to each piece. The dimensions of a solo square birthstone charm are typically 0.5 cm in length and width, with a 0.2 cm thickness and a 0.5 cm hole for attachment. The gemstones used are often zircons, chosen for their brilliance and affordability.

Care and Maintenance

Proper care is essential to maintain the beauty and longevity of birthstone charms. While specific care instructions may vary depending on the gemstone and metal used, general guidelines include avoiding exposure to harsh chemicals, such as cleaning agents and perfumes. Regular cleaning with a soft cloth can help remove dirt and oils, preserving the charm's shine. It is also advisable to store charms separately from other jewelry to prevent scratching or damage.

Historical Context and Modern Trends

While the practice of wearing birthstone charms as a form of personalized jewelry is relatively recent, the association of gemstones with specific months dates back centuries. Ancient cultures attributed various powers and meanings to different stones, believing they could influence health, fortune, and emotions. The modern birthstone list evolved over time, with variations existing across different cultures and historical periods. Today, birthstone charms represent a contemporary interpretation of this ancient tradition, offering a stylish and meaningful way to connect with the symbolism of gemstones.
